How much does a Legal Reference Librarian I make in Connecticut? The average Legal Reference Librarian I salary in Connecticut is $58,600 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$49,700 and $66,600.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

The Legal Reference Librarian I researches publications and suggests new sources and offerings for acquisition or subscriptions that will meet ongoing information needs. Performs legal and non-legal research and maintains and develops a library of print and digital resources for legal staff. Being a Legal Reference Librarian I monitors budget and expenses, processes invoices, and maintains subscriptions to information services. Establishes standard procedures for information gathering and trains staff on information request processes. In addition, Legal Reference Librarian I coordinates with technical resources to select and maintain the technology infrastructure and tools used in the library.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. Being a Legal Reference Librarian I work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Working as a Legal Reference Librarian I typ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
